Abstract
© Springer International Publishing Switzerland 2015. It is shown experimentally that in a two-dimensional array of Permalloy nanodots the lifetime of the electromagnetic microwave radiation at the subharmonic frequency originated from the parametrically excited ferromagnetic resonance mode is increased by two orders of magnitude compared to the case of a continuous magnetic film.
